Principal Financial Group Inc. Acquires 15,868 Shares of NMI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:NMIH)

Principal Financial Group Inc. increased its position in shares of NMI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:NMIH - Free Report) by 3.6%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 452,264 shares of the financial services provider's stock after buying an additional 15,868 shares during the quarter. Principal Financial Group Inc. owned 0.57% of NMI worth $16,625,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

A number of other institutional investors have also added to or reduced their stakes in NMIH. Barclays PLC boosted its holdings in NMI by 264.4% during the third qu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 386,999 shares of the financial services provider's stock valued at $15,940,000 after purchasing an additional 280,809 shares in the last quarter. abrdn plc acquired a new stake in NMI during the fourth quarter valued at approximately $8,122,000. FMR LLC boosted its holdings in NMI by 7.6% during the third quarter. FMR LLC now owns 1,517,092 shares of the financial services provider's stock valued at $62,489,000 after purchasing an additional 107,771 shares in the last quarter. Taika Capital LP acquired a new stake in NMI during the third quarter valued at approximately $4,071,000. Finally, Donald Smith & CO. Inc. boosted its holdings in NMI by 11.1% during the third quarter. Donald Smith & CO. Inc. now owns 969,872 shares of the financial services provider's stock valued at $39,949,000 after purchasing an additional 97,125 shares in the last quarter. 94.12% of the stock is ow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

NMI Profile

NMI Holdings, Inc provides private mortgage guaranty insurance services in the United States. The company offers mortgage insurance services, such as primary and pool insurance; and outsourced loan review services to mortgage loan originators. It serves national and regional mortgage banks, money center banks, credit unions, community banks, builder-owned mortgage lenders, internet-sourced lenders, and other non-bank lenders.
